(Lamoine) — Selectmen dealt with a complaint from resident William Fennelly against the Transfer Station Manager and the Administrative Assistant. Mr. Fennelly said the transfer station was not adequately shoveled, and the manager was smoking inside his office. He said he was barred from making a complaint about improperly disposed of trash when the Administrative Assistant threw him out of the town office.
Selectmen investigated the complaints, and reminded the Transfer
Station Manager about the smoking policy. A letter will go to the trash generator
warning him to properly dispose of building debris. The Board found the complaints
against the Administrative Assistant to be unfounded. The board found that
Mr. Fennelly was asked to leave the office when he used inappropriate language.
A witness corroborated the account. Mr. Fennelly was also asked to leave the
Selectmen’s meeting by Board Chair Jo Cooper after making a threat.
